The Meeting Point and Ease of Access
Your holiday journey begins at a convenient spot on the corner of 59th St. and 7th Ave., directly across from the New York Athletic Club. It’s easy to find, especially after a day of sightseeing in Midtown, and the meeting instructions are straightforward. Arriving here, you’ll find your guide ready to escort you to your decorated carriage, setting the tone for a festive ride.

The Practicalities: Price, Duration, and Group Size
At $282 per group (up to four people), the ride offers good value considering the intimacy and the personalized service. The private group setting means you won’t be stuck in a large tour, and the 45-minute duration strikes a balance between seeing key sights and not overcommitting your time.
You can choose to reserve now and pay later, providing flexibility if your plans shift. And with full cancellation rights up to 24 hours in advance, there’s peace of mind if your schedule changes unexpectedly.

FAQ
Is this a private group experience?
Yes, it is designed for private groups up to four people, ensuring a personalized experience.
How long is the ride?
The ride lasts approximately 45 minutes, making it a manageable window to enjoy the festive sights.
What is included in the price?
Your ticket covers the carriage ride, carrots for the horse, cozy blankets, and a guide.
Where do I meet the guide?
You meet on the corner of 59th St. and 7th Ave., across from the New York Athletic Club.
Can I cancel the reservation?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.
Is there a preferred time for the ride?
The experience is usually available in the evening and at night, perfect for seeing the park illuminated.
How many people can fit in the carriage?
Up to four people, ideal for small groups or couples.
Is the experience suitable for children?
While not explicitly stated, many reviews suggest families with children enjoy the tour, especially if they love holiday lights.
What should I wear?
Dress warmly, as the ride is outdoors and takes place in winter weather. Bring layers and hats.
Is the guide knowledgeable?
Yes, the guide is described as friendly and informative, adding to the overall enjoyment.
Can I book now and pay later?
Absolutely. You can reserve your spot without immediate payment, offering flexibility in planning.
